Блок питания в протеусе

Блок питания в протеусе

В предыдущей статье я рассказал о базовых принципах работы в PROTEUS’е. В этой же я покажу, как симулировать работу микросхем цифровой логики, использовать специальные инструменты (осциллограф, генератор, вольтметр и др.), а так же о работе в ARES.

Работу цифровых микросхем в PROTEUSе не так уж и сложно моделировать, проблема лишь в том, что при составлении схем нужно помнить, что PROTEUS – программа ТЕОРЕТИЧЕСКАЯ и поэтому устройства, работающие на практике не всегда удаться смоделировать в ней, и наоборот.

Так прекрасно работающий генератор на двух логических элементах ТТЛ логики при симуляции не заработает, так как это идеальный мультивибратор, и для запуска на входах элементов должен быть некий потенциал, чего при симуляции в PROTEUS’е естественно не будет. Теперь о питании микросхем: в предыдущей статье я настоятельно советовал всегда укладываться в синий прямоугольник, теперь поясню – в пределах этого прямоугольника работает "автотрассировщик", а также шины питания микросхем (дело в том, что питание на микросхемы подводится через шины VCC и GND), выбрать их можно следующим образом: на левой панели выбрать "Terminals Mode" ("Терминал"), в рядом расположенном окошке высветятся варианты, нам же нужны лишь "POWER" и "GROUND".

С "GROUND" все понятно – это корпус ("земля"), а вот "POWER" еще нужно выбрать. Выбор шины питания производится уже после перетаскивания значка питания или заземления на "рабочее поле", так для ТТЛ микросхем нужно выбрать "Правка свойств — Строка- VCC", а для КМОП-тоже самое, но VDD, GND не трогаем, он уже установлен "по умолчанию". То, что я перечислил выше справедливо, если при моделировании мы выбираем источник питания-батарею, если же мы просто хотим просмотреть работу микросхем или блоков на них, то источник можно не указывать, он как бы встроен внутрь этого мистического "синего прямоугольника". Теперь, зная как установить питание и некоторые особенности моделирования можно приступить к последнему. Для начала попробуем смоделировать работу счетчика-дешифратора на микросхемах ТТЛ логики (7493 и 74154). Вот так выглядит схема:

Читайте также:  Не удается открыть источник файл errno h

Так как мы симулируем лишь работу счетчика и дешифратора, то генератор собранный на микросхеме можно опустить, а вместо него вставить очень полезный инструмент с той же функцией. Этот инструмент называется "Часовой генератор" и генерирует прямоугольные колебания с частотой, которая устанавливается вручную (по умолчанию 1 Гц). На схеме он отображается так:

Вообще, в PROTEUS’е существуют различные генераторы: синусоиды, аудио и др. посмотреть и поэкспериментировать с ними можно кликнув на значок "Генератор". На левой панели программы.

В окошке справа высветятся варианты генераторов. После того как вы расположили элементы схемы и соединили их нужно выставить частоту генератора. Это можно сделать кликнув по значку генератора левой кнопкой мыши два раза. В открывшемся окне в графе частота изменить частоту на 10 Гц. Теперь можно жать на "Пуск" и наслаждаться результатом.

Теперь о работе в Ares.Чтобы открыть текучий проект из PROTEUS’а в ARES, нужно нажать на значок ARES на верхней панели. Откроется окно программы:

Сначала нам потребуется выделить область для автоматического размещения компонентов на плате, это делается следующим образом: выбираете элемент 2-D графики квадрат:

потом в левом нижнем углу из списка слоев выбираете слой Board Edge

и рисуете внутри синего прямоугольника квадрат или прямоугольник желтого цвета, примерно так :

Теперь жмем на "Сервис" — "авторазмещение", во всплывающем окне жмем "ОК". После этого программа сама размещает элементы на плате, но дорожки пока не рисует.

Выглядит неказисто, но для этого программа дорожки не нарисовала, мы можем спокойно поменять расположение элементов. Для этого просто щелкаем по элементу правой кнопкой мыши и выбираем пункт "Перетащить". Я расположил элементы так:

Элементы расположены, можно разводить плату. Для этого нужно выбрать "Сервис", пункт "Автотрассировка", во всплывшем окне жмем "ОК". И вуаля!

Читайте также:  Супер мтс 092014 описание тарифа новосибирск

Программа все за нас сделала! Теперь, если мы хотим полюбоваться внешним видом платы выбираем «Вывод», пункт 3-D визуализация! Кстати, хочу обратить ваше внимание на одну деталь-имена проектов в протеусе пишите на АНГЛИЙСКОМ, иначе они в ARES не откроются!

Удачи вам в ваших экспериментах. Что касается микроконтроллеров, то оставим их до следующей статьи!

Попробовал я симулировать работу схемы дежурного блока питания, простейшего типа на биполярном транзисторе. Сначала ничего не выходило. После непродолжительной игры «запустил» данную схему.

Пришлось скопировать/вставить элементы в другой проект и изменить в нем Gmin (System/Set Simulation Options) до 10n (1e-08). Также пришлось подобрать параметры трансформатора. Вот что вышло (индуктивность первичной 3200мкГн, передаточное число к вспомогательной обмотке — 5, вместе с трансформатором — R8/C2 — задают частоту работы)

Вот файл проекта, для Proteus 8.5, если кто хочет поэксперементировать — test_5vsb_npn

Вот тут написано пару слов про настройку эмулятора «Протеуса» — converg.

Если вы нашли ошибку, пожалуйста, выделите фрагмент текста и нажмите Ctrl+Enter.

Добавить комментарий Отменить ответ

Этот сайт использует Akismet для борьбы со спамом. Узнайте как обрабатываются ваши данные комментариев.

Автор: Сергей. Опубликовано в Начинающим CV AVR

Прекрасная программа для всех радиолюбителей, в которой можно предварительно опробовать интересную цифровую или аналоговую схему.

С этой программой надо дружить, и учится правильно применять эту программу, что значительно ускорит доводку схем к более совершенному варианту..

В статье несколько проектов схем в Proteus .

Общаться с протеусом, можно начать например и с такой схемы .

Видео работы с Proteus , составление схемы и печатной платы (в т.ч. 3D модель).

Файл PROTEUS к данному видео — скачать.

Читайте также:  Пропала сетка в автокаде

DC — DC преобразователь MC34063. микросхема К176ИЕ12

Проекты на интегральном таймере 555.

Секундомер ATtiny2313. Bin-calcul.

Часы с индикаторами большого формата, ATmega8. Кухонный таймер

Часы секундомер ATtiny2313 ; счетчик дозатор ATtiny2313; таймер ATmega8

Таймер для насоса ATtiny2313; циклический таймер ATtiny2313

счетчик — ваттметр МК ATmega8; Transistortester на ATmega8; таймер pic16f873a

Термостат ∆T=0,1°C ATtiny2313; Термостат 0,1°C и многоканальным выходом; Сторож паяльника ATtiny2313.

Вольтметр 220 вольт ATmega8; Вольтамперметр PIC16F676; измеритель ёмкости ATtiny2313.

Цифровой сумеречнй переключатель ATmega8; Термостат 8 зон ATtiny2313 + ne556.

Термостат шим 3 канала ATmega8; Вольт амперметр PIC16F88 Паяльная станция ATmega8;

Титан — термо PIC16F84A Вольтамперметр с уставками PIC16F873A Часы термометр PIC16F873A

Управление тенами PIC16F876A Контроллер до 999 °C PIC16F676A

измеритель ESR ATtiny2313 Радио №6/2010 Термовольтметр PIC16F876

Вольтамперметр с контролем

по нижним и верхним пределам 16F676 Спидометр — одометр ЖКИ16х2 , 16х4 ATmega8;

Здесь в конце, статьи проекты для теста 🙁 , они тоже заслуживают внимания,

так как схемы в реальных устройствах работают отлично.

Металлодетектор на ATmega8; CLR2313 ATtiny2313.

Не забывать, когда в протеус обновляеш версии прошивок работающими с EEPROM , нужно делать периодически сброс постоянных модели

Если проект в протеусе не корректно отображает кирилицу на ЖКИ, для правильного отображения кирилицы на ЖК индикаторе распаковать эту библиотеку в папку models протеуса

Ссылка на основную публикацию
The godfather вылетает при запуске
Файл the godfather 2 the game_code.exe из Electronic Arts является частью Unified Registration code installer program. the godfather 2 the...
Kms активатор windows 10 без вирусов
Данный способ, благодаря которому утилита снимает ограничения, изначально использовался Microsoft для того, чтобы облегчить лицензирование платформ и пакета Office. KMSAuto...
Kyocera fs 1025mfp сканирование по сети
Возможно, клиент пытается сканировать через сетевой интерфейс, что у данных МФУ невозможно. Доступные технологии сканирования – TWAIN, WIA, сканирование в...
Tmpfile1 в папке temp
Файл tmpfile1.exe из - является частью -. tmpfile1.exe, расположенный в Unknown file path с размером файла unknown байт, версия файла...
Adblock detector